However, when it comes time for a replacement, things can get a bi...A time-series graph shows how the value of a particular variable or variables has changed over some period of time. One of the variables in a time-series graph is time itself. Time is typically placed on the horizontal axis in time-series graphs. The other axis can represent any variable whose value changes over time. Line chart. Line charts show changes in value across continuous measurements, such as those made over time. Movement of the line up or down helps bring out positive and negative changes, respectively. It can also expose overall trends, to help the reader make predictions or projections for future outcomes. Blackadder Goes Forth. 1989 6 eps TV-PG. 8.8 …A Time Series chart is a graph that you can use to evaluate patterns and behaviour in data over time. Time Series chart displays observation on the y-axis against equally spaced time intervals on the x-axis. Time Series charts are often used to examine daily, weekly, seasonal or annual variations, or before-and-after effects …

Time series graphs are created by plotting an aggregated value (either a count or a statistic, such as sum or average) on a time line. The values are aggregated using time intervals based on the time range in the data being plotted. The following time intervals are used on time series graphs: One decade; Three years ...5. Regression analysis. Azure Data Explorer supports segmented linear regression analysis to estimate the trend of the time series. Use series_fit_line () to fit the best line to a time series for general trend detection.
